Subject: Mail Room Relocation — Action Needed

Hello Facilities Desk,

As of Thursday, the mail room at Quillhaven Tower moves from Suite 104 to the lower mezzanine, next to the print hub. Please update signage, redirect the courier trolleys, and inform the morning sorters before their first run. The mezzanine corridor stays locked outside sorting hours, so staff will need keypad access. For the duration of the move, the corridor door accepts the following badge code.

badge for fafop-fajof: bdg-Z-47

## Session Handling — TileForge Cache Layer

TileForge caches rendered map tiles per session. Session keys derive from the render profile hash, not user identity. Cache entries expire after 15 minutes; eviction is LRU. Cross-session reads are blocked at the proxy, so poisoning requires a valid upstream credential. Invalidation calls hit the purge endpoint directly and bypass the CDN. All purge requests must authenticate with the following bearer token.

portal login ticket: eyJhbGciOiJIUzI1NiIsInR5cCI6IkpXVCJ9.eyJzdWIiOiIMjvRAf3PEFIn0.nuv9gjixLtnr

## Legacy Pricing Adjustment — Managers Only

Branch managers: from next quarter, customers on legacy Thornfield tariffs move to the Ridgeline schedule, a 9% average increase. Please review the exemption criteria carefully — accounts flagged under the hardship policy are excluded, as are multi-site contracts renewed within the past year. Customer letters go out in phases by branch. The timing reflects the considerations set out below.

board note of faduf-tawef: The board signed off on a budget of $14.4 million for Project Tamion. The renewal with Druaelek Logistics closes at $54.7 million a year, 13 percent above the last contract.